OTTAWA (CP) – Paul Martin’s position in negotiations over East Coast oil royalties and equalization payments would keep Atlantic Canada poor, Conservative Leader Stephen Harper charged Thursday.
And he moved a motion in the House of Commons calling the prime minister’s attitude “deplorable.”
Harper said Newfoundland and Nova Scotia should be treated no differently than Alberta was in the 1950s when oil and gas were just beginning to fuel the province’s economy.
He said Alberta was allowed to keep its oil royalties without clawbacks on its equalization payments and that allowed it to become a modern-day powerhouse.
Atlantic Canada deserves the same, Harper said, and he called on Martin to fulfil an election campaign promise to Newfoundland Premier Danny Williams.
